No Kullu-UT flight from December 17

Our Correspondent

Kullu, December 13

Air India will not operate its regular flights between Kullu and Chandigarh from December 17 to January 15.

The airline had recently stopped ticket booking after December 15 and now the scheduled flight has been cancelled till January 15.

Sources said operations between Kullu and Chandigarh would not be carried out due to unfavourable weather conditions, however flights between Delhi and Kullu would continue as permitted by the weather.

Air India was carrying out daily operations between Kullu and Chandigarh, except on Sundays. The operations were being carried out using the same 70-seater ATR-72 aircraft that was operating between Kullu and Delhi. The operations were successful and the airline charged hefty fares for the 40-minute journey between Kullu and Chandigarh during the peak season.

During the inaugural flight to Chandigarh on October 5, 2017, Minister of State for Civil Aviation Jayant Sinha had stated that the Kullu-Chandigarh sector would be included in second version of UDAN (Ude Desh Ka Aam Naagrik) scheme and the fares would be reduced further.

The 70-seater aircraft is allowed to ferry around 30 passengers while departing from Kullu due to load stipulation because of the short runway. The aircraft is allowed to bring in around 40 passengers while landing at the Kullu-Manali airport in Bhuntar.
